Side-by-Side Comparison

Feature largo lasso
Definition Très lentement. On le met en tête d’un morceau de musique pour indiquer qu’on doit le jouer très lentement. Longue lanière en forme de boucle dont se servent les gardiens de troupeaux, comme les cow-boys ou les gardians, pour s’emparer des chevaux, des bœufs sauvages, en la leur lançant autour du corps.
